  4. Made a trip to Diamond City last weekend to dive and the thermocline was right around 20'. Made a quick recovery dive in the dam area on Table Rock this evening and the water was warm all the way to 20'. Didn't have a wetsuit on, so we didn't venture out to far, but it was getting cooler right past the 20' mark.

  8. Put in at Peel and went back toward Lead Hill to dive today. Vis is definitely better on Bull Shoals than Table Rock right now. Spent most of our time in the 30 to 40 ft range. Vis was decent down there like you had reported (10' to 12'), and maybe even better in a few spots?? We saw some walleye, bass and one carp, but nothing of any size. We did see lots of 3" to 5" bass in the 15' range on our first spot in the brush. We might have been to deep but I thought we'd see more fish than we did. Diving in the brush wasn't ideal so we backed out to 30+ to dive the edge of the brush line. Glad I took the wetsuit because the temp dropped around the 25ft mark and it was pretty cool down there!
